A recent TruStage Risk alert warns about an emerging check fraud trend, the manipulation of the magnetic ink character recognition (MICR) line at the bottom of deposited checks. Fraudsters are adding faint routing symbols and characters to the MICR line which disrupts how these items are read and cleared through image-based processing systems. These items are then coming through as adjustments rather than returns long after check holds expire.
